GETY Stock Analysis - Frequently Asked Questions

Getty Images' stock was trading at $2.16 on January 1st, 2025. Since then, GETY stock has increased by 6.7% and is now trading at $2.3050.

Getty Images Holdings, Inc. (NYSE:GETY) announced its quarterly earnings data on Monday, August, 11th. The company reported ($0.08) earnings per share for the quarter, missing analysts' consensus estimates of $0.03 by $0.11. The firm's quarterly revenue was up 2.5% compared to the same quarter last year.
